MUR410 Diode:

Product Overview

The MUR410 diode belongs to the category of ultrafast rectifier diodes. These diodes are commonly used in power supply and switching applications due to their fast recovery time and low forward voltage drop. The MUR410 diode is known for its high efficiency, reliability, and robustness. It is available in various package types such as DO-201AD and TO-220AC, and typically comes in reels or tubes.

Specifications

  • Maximum Average Forward Current: 4A
  • Reverse Voltage: 100V
  • Forward Voltage Drop: 0.93V at 1A
  • Reverse Recovery Time: 35ns

Detailed Pin Configuration

The MUR410 diode has a standard two-pin configuration with the anode and cathode terminals clearly marked. The anode is denoted by a longer lead or a "+" symbol, while the cathode is identified by a shorter lead or a "-" symbol.

Functional Features

The MUR410 diode offers ultrafast recovery times, making it suitable for high-frequency applications. It also exhibits low reverse recovery current, which minimizes switching losses and enhances overall system efficiency. Additionally, its low forward voltage drop reduces power dissipation, contributing to improved energy efficiency.

Working Principles

The MUR410 diode operates based on the principle of rectification, allowing current to flow in only one direction while blocking it in the reverse direction. Its ultrafast recovery time ensures minimal reverse recovery charge, enabling rapid switching and efficient energy conversion.

Detailed Application Field Plans

The MUR410 diode finds extensive use in various applications, including: - Switching power supplies - DC-DC converters - Freewheeling diodes in inductive load circuits - Flyback diodes in relay and solenoid drivers
